Chapter 46 - Chapter 046: The Infected Ones

After brushing off matters concerning the clan, Satori Hyūga made his way back to his assembly warehouse.

This was, after all, his current financial lifeline. He often came by just to check in and ensure everything remained secure.

Of course, with Might Guy around, danger was usually minimal.

Even an elite Jonin wouldn't necessarily gain any advantage trying to sneak in on Guy.

The Eight Gates were always ready to open, freeing Guy from his usual constraints and giving him greater initiative.

Being able to activate the Eight Gates at will also significantly lessened the physical toll it took.

As he approached the warehouse entrance, he heard loud, passionate shouting from inside.

Something about youthful fire and extolling the glory of youth—it fit Guy perfectly, nothing out of the ordinary.

What surprised Satori, however, was that besides Guy, several other familiar voices joined in.

They sounded like the young boys from the Hyūga Clan.

"No way… No way… Did they actually get infected too?"

Pushing the door open, Satori immediately laid eyes on a rather shocking sight.

The Hyūga youths, somehow without him noticing, had started dressing exactly like Guy—in bright green spandex suits.

From their once refined, pretty-boy image, they'd become something straight out of a comedy sketch—a group of outright perverts.

Witnessing this, Satori's lips twitched slightly—he barely kept his face composed.

"What is this…?"

Upon seeing Satori arrive, Guy instantly rushed over, excitedly greeting him.

"Boss! Look at our new uniforms! So full of energy! So bursting with youth! How about getting one for yourself too?"

Saying that, he pulled out another green jumpsuit from behind his back.

"This outfit is light, breathable, and flexible—perfect for training Taijutsu."

"In fact, everyone chose it specifically for their body training!"

He said proudly, turning around to show Satori the rest of the people dressed in green spandex.

The Branch House boys looked visibly embarrassed, avoiding direct eye contact with Satori.

They feared that as a Main House member, Satori would scold them for their ridiculous attire.

But Satori didn't.

His lips twitched again, and he quickly declined Guy's offer.

"No thanks—you just focus on your training."

"I'm currently researching Ninjutsu and conducting scientific studies—I don't have time to wear that and work out."

"You can wear it during training, but avoid walking around the compound in it. The elders are elderly—they might not survive the sight."

Satori had no desire to see the entire Hyūga compound shift from traditional black-and-white kimono-wearing members to an army of green-clad spandex enthusiasts.

Even though he practiced Taijutsu himself, he still felt the green spandex wasn't right for him.

He preferred loose athletic clothing much more.

The boys gave awkward smiles and nodded repeatedly.

"We'll keep them covered inside the compound—no hint of green shows until we start training," Chonghuo Hyūga explained.

They weren't unaware that the outfits looked rather strange.

Might Guy had displayed incredible strength, and he kept insisting that wearing the green jumpsuit could boost one's strength. 

When someone this strong says something, there must be some truth to it. 

That was why the group collectively decided to give it a shot. 

However, most of the kids cared about their image and put on a formal act around outsiders, though they didn't actually dress like that. 

Only during training sessions in the warehouse did they finally let go of their inhibitions. 

Only Might Guy remained completely carefree, smiling happily as if every taunt directed at him was encouragement instead. 

His belief in the Ninja Way was unshakable, impervious to doubt. 

Unfortunately, his talent wasn't great and his upbringing was humble, or else his ceiling would have been much higher. 

Luckily, he met Satori Hyūga. Familiar with the plot, Satori upgraded Guy's living and training conditions. 

As long as Guy continued pushing forward with determination and followed rigorous training methods, his strength would surely grow—far beyond what was shown in the original story. 

Watching these young boys endure hardships and train diligently, Satori made no attempt to stop or scold them. 

Just the fact that they were willing to wear those green jumpsuits showed how resolute they were in their pursuit of strength. 

Training under Might Guy meant gaining real results—and ultimately benefiting themselves. 

As a Main House member, along with being their teacher and boss, Satori knew they would naturally become loyal to him. 

"If they're all wearing green jumpsuits to get stronger, I shouldn't fall too far behind either." 

"If my subordinates surpass me, that'll be embarrassing." 

After leaving the warehouse, Satori thought for a while and decided to undergo intense training himself. 

He wasn't like those idle nobles in the Main House who lived off their titles. 

Though he outwardly appeared humble and kind, inwardly he was fiercely proud. 

As someone who had crossed over from another world, even if he wouldn't dare challenge a Kage or rival a Daimyo directly, he certainly wouldn't allow himself to be surpassed by his peers. 

Especially now that the Eight Gates had been refined—the damage caused by Opening Gate significantly reduced, without draining as much life energy. 

There was simply no excuse not to train. 

"Training is important, but scientific workouts are just as essential. If I design custom fitness equipment, maybe I can double my efficiency." 

"I remember some gym machines from my previous life. They should still work. Just double the weight and resistance." 

Satori sketched out some exercise equipment from his past life and ordered custom-built versions for himself. 

These days, he had sold quite a few massage chairs—he had no shortage of money anymore. 

Many merchants came looking for him, hoping to obtain distribution rights. 

So for him, anything that could be solved with money was just a small matter. 

Activating the Eight Gates, especially the Opening Gate, was essentially about repeatedly surpassing human limits and breaking past physical endurance. 

In the original series, when Might Guy and Might Kai trained, they ran around Konoha, did squats and frog jumps. 

It wasn't that such training was ineffective—it was simply too slow. 

Ninjas possessed tremendous strength and regeneration abilities, meaning reaching their physical limit required dozens, even hundreds of laps. 

Satori didn't have time to wait that long. 

And he definitely didn't want to run around Konoha like a monkey being pointed at and laughed at. 

Importing a treadmill from his past life for training was far more efficient than outdoor running.

There was also the matter of choosing specific equipment to train particular body parts.

[Weightlifting], [Squats], [Bench Presses]...

Back in his previous life, gyms were full of countless types of equipment; if he could just replicate them here, physical training would become incredibly easy.

However, what Satori Hyūga desired most was the gravity chamber from Dragon Ball.

[Earth Release: Heavy Weight Rock Technique] — a Ninjutsu from Iwagakure — could increase an object's weight, achieving an effect similar to gravity manipulation.

The Rinnegan and Tenseigan also exhibited similar powers of repulsion and attraction.

Unfortunately, at this point, Satori had no way of obtaining any of them.

[Earth Release: Heavy Weight Rock Technique] was a signature jutsu of The Third Tsuchikage and would not be easily shared with outsiders.

Especially considering Satori belonged to the Hyūga Clan of Konoha.

As for the Rinnegan and Tenseigan, they were even less attainable.

For all anyone knew, Madara Uchiha might not have even awakened the Rinnegan yet.

As for the Tenseigan, it was even less attainable — after all, who could reach the moon from the earth? Satori currently lacked the ability to travel there.

Perhaps there was a connection between his clan and the Ōtsutsuki of the moon, but Satori had no way of accessing that knowledge at the moment.

Satori knew his strength was still too weak to take control of such matters. For now, he could only grow quietly in the shadows.
